About

Gerhard H. Jirka is a scholar working on Computational Mechanics, Oceanography and Ecology. According to data from OpenAlex, Gerhard H. Jirka has authored 117 papers receiving a total of 4.7k indexed citations (citations by other indexed papers that have themselves been cited), including 43 papers in Computational Mechanics, 27 papers in Oceanography and 26 papers in Ecology. Recurrent topics in Gerhard H. Jirka’s work include Fluid Dynamics and Turbulent Flows (39 papers), Hydrology and Sediment Transport Processes (26 papers) and Aerodynamics and Acoustics in Jet Flows (23 papers). Gerhard H. Jirka is often cited by papers focused on Fluid Dynamics and Turbulent Flows (39 papers), Hydrology and Sediment Transport Processes (26 papers) and Aerodynamics and Acoustics in Jet Flows (23 papers). Gerhard H. Jirka collaborates with scholars based in United States, Germany and France. Gerhard H. Jirka's co-authors include Iehisa NEZU, Hiroji Nakagawa, Daoyi Chen, Douglas B. Moog, Volker Weitbrecht, Scott A. Socolofsky, B. Brumley, Tobias Bleninger, Chia‐Ren Chu and Herlina Herlina and has published in prestigious journals such as Environmental Science & Technology, Journal of Fluid Mechanics and Journal of The Electrochemical Society.
